Last version of CoolVLV shows a (IMHO unusually) high CPU use from SLVoice plugin. Plugin alone uses 28-30% of CPU. Please note I'm the only avatar in the sim and I'm not using voice (eg the mic is off). Tried to switch voice off and CPU reverts to 2-3% Switching on again reverts to ~30% I tried with other viewers (Firestorm/Alchemy) and SLVoice stands about 2-3%
It looks like a bug in your tasks monitor: the viewer consuming only 3% of a CPU core while voice consumes 26% ?... Impossible ! The viewer itself normally consumes 100 to 160% of a CPU core (once everything is rezzed, and up to 300%, i.e. 3 full cores while rezzing), since it consumes a full core to render and the 3D driver itself is ran with multi-threading on, which means at least 30-60% of a core consumption added.
In any case, I cannot reproduce here what your are seeing on your system (I get 160% for the viewer on a 2500K @ 4.6GHz + GTX970 and SLVoice between 0 and 4%).
In this screenshot I have two viewers with activated voice: a bug in the task monitor (BTW this time I used another one, htop) should show same wrong values for both?

Pulseaudio at 19%... I'd suspect an issue with it (that could cause SLVoice to loop forever, waiting for Pulseaudio).
In any case, I'm afraid there is nothing I can do: beside the fact I cannot reproduce your issue (see the attached screenshot), SLVoice is closed source...
Note also that the Cool VL Viewer is using Snowglobe's v1 SLVoice (unlike all other current viewers), and that I do not plan on updating it to a newer version (it would involve rewriting voice support in the viewer, and since I do not use voice myself, I've got zero motivation and no time to do it).
